Most things are way easier to make at home than you’d imagine! Including simple staples like this brown sugaršŸ‘‡šŸ¼ 1 cup organic cane sugar 1 tbsp molasses As a mom who cares about ingredients, I’ve spent years putting together recipes that I actually trust. Highly requested lavender lemonade! 1 cup water 1 cup raw cane sugar 3 tbsp dried lavender buds 4 lemons, juiced 6 cups water 1/2 cup purƩed blueberries (optional) 2 cups ice Start by making a lavender simple syrup. Add 1 cup water, 1 cup sugar, and 3 tbsp of lavender into a small pot. Cook
